Norfolk Broads and Water-Based Activities

The Norfolk Broads are one of the county's biggest attractions and offer unique family experiences.

Popular activities include:

  • Family boat hire

  • Canoeing

  • Paddleboarding

  • Kayaking

  • Wildlife boat trips

  • Riverside walks

Families looking for outdoor summer adventures often choose the Broads for a day of exploration on the water.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: What are the best family days out in Norfolk?

A: Popular attractions include BeWILDerwood, Banham Zoo, ROARR!, Dinosaur Adventure, the Norfolk Broads and Norfolk's award-winning beaches.

Q: What can children do during the Norfolk summer holidays?

A: Children can enjoy beach days, wildlife attractions, outdoor adventures, water sports, cycling, creative workshops, sports activities and organised activity camps.

Q: Are there summer camps in Norfolk?

A: Yes. Barracudas operates a summer activity camp in Norwich for children aged 4½–14 years, offering over 80 activities and flexible childcare options during the summer holidays.

Q: What are the best beaches in Norfolk for families?

A: Wells-next-the-Sea, Holkham Beach, Cromer Beach, Sheringham Beach and Sea Palling Beach are among the most popular family-friendly beaches in Norfolk.
